Junior Project Manager
Overview:
An industrial HVAC equipment and services provider is seeking a motivated Junior Project Manager to support project management, estimating, purchasing, and administrative tasks within the construction department. This role plays a key part in project execution and operational efficiency.
Responsibilities:
Estimating (Bid Preparation & Costing)
- Review, organize, and distribute bid requests and documents.
- Gather pricing from subcontractors/vendors and assist with takeoffs.
- Enter labor and material costs for small projects and generate proposals.
- Obtain construction manager approval for estimates and proposals.
Purchasing & Procurement
- Identify and procure necessary materials and equipment for projects.
- Negotiate pricing and issue purchase orders with approval.
- Review and approve equipment submittals for design-build jobs.
- Track, schedule, and coordinate deliveries and subcontractor work.
Project Management
- Schedule and coordinate job activities with contractors, foremen, and technicians.
- Manage job progress, manpower, and resource allocation.
- Dispatch technicians and adjust schedules as needed.
Administrative (Job & Cost Management)
- Create and track budgets for new jobs.
- Maintain job cost sheets and enter data into internal systems (VMS).
- Organize and archive job folders as needed.
Accounts Payable & Purchasing Records
- Set up new vendors and subcontractors in VMS.
- Generate and distribute purchase orders.
- Review and approve invoices for accuracy.
Billing & Accounts Receivable
- Track project costs and generate monthly invoices.
- Prepare AIA invoices and lien waivers with manager approval.
- Follow up on outstanding invoices with customers.
General HR & Office Tasks
- Process timesheets and enter payroll data.
- Assist HR with insurance, uniform orders, and scheduling.
- Order tools, supplies, and job-related materials as needed.
- Address employee concerns and escalate to HR when necessary.
